A mesothelioma lawyer with experience can assist victims to receive the most amount of compensation within an acceptable time frame.<br />If a patient with mesothelioma is able to meet the SSDI eligibility requirements They will be required to provide medical evidence that supports their condition. The most reliable evidence is the pathology report that can identify mesothelioma tumor cells in the form of a biopsy. Other documents that confirm the diagnosis include hospital documents, doctor's notes and statements from family members.<br />Before giving disability benefits, the SSA will also evaluate the prognosis of the patient and evaluate their capacity to work. If a mesothelioma patient is unable to work then they are entitled to monthly disability checks. These benefits are based on the average lifetime earnings they contributed to Social Security. Mesothelioma victims may also be eligible for disability benefits from the state and additional assistance, which is not funded through Social Security taxes.<br />An attorney for mesothelioma can assist clients through the disability claims process of the SSA by helping them gather the required medical documentation.
